
KKR Clinch Thrilling 1-Run Victory Over Rajasthan Royals at Eden Gardens; Juhi Chawla Sends Wishes
May 04, 2025: In a nail-biting IPL 2024 encounter at Eden Gardens,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) edged past Rajasthan Royals (RR) by just 1 run, prompting cheers from fans and co-owner Juhi Chawla. The Bollywood actor shared her delight and extended best wishes to the team, saying, “All the best to all the players in our team, KKR. All our best wishes are with you.”
Batting first, KKR posted an imposing 206/4 in 20 overs. Despite the early loss of Sunil Narine, a solid partnership between skipper Ajinkya Rahane and Rahmanullah Gurbaz (35 off 25) set the tone. The real momentum came from a fiery 61-run partnership between Angkrish Raghuvanshi (44 off 31) and Andre Russell, who smashed an unbeaten 57 off just 25 balls. Russell was well-supported by Rinku Singh, who contributed a quick 19* off 6 balls.
In response, RR found themselves struggling at 71/5. However, Riyan Parag played a breathtaking innings of 95 off 45 balls, forming a crucial 92-run stand with Shimron Hetmyer (29 off 23). Late fireworks from Shubham Dubey (25* off 14) and Jofra Archer (12 off 8) brought RR within touching distance, but they eventually fell short, finishing at 205/8.
For KKR, Varun Chakravarthy, Harshit Rana, and Moeen Ali each picked two wickets, playing a key role in securing the narrow win.
The match goes down as one of the most thrilling of the season, reaffirming KKR’s strong run and delighting home fans in Kolkata.
